The Art of Peruvian Handicrafts

The Centro Artesanal Cusco is a treasure trove of traditional Peruvian handicrafts, showcasing the rich cultural heritage of the region. You'll find everything from intricately woven textiles to hand-painted ceramics and unique jewelry. Many of these crafts are made using techniques passed down through generations, reflecting the artistry and skill of local artisans. TikTok+1

When exploring the stalls, take note of the materials used. Alpaca wool is a popular choice for its warmth and softness, evident in the beautiful ponchos, scarves, and sweaters. Ceramics often feature vibrant colors and traditional motifs, while leather goods offer a more practical yet stylish souvenir option. Don't miss the opportunity to see some of the artisans at work, offering a glimpse into their creative process. TikTok

It's important to remember that these are handmade items, and slight variations are part of their charm. Supporting these artisans directly ensures that these traditional crafts continue to thrive. Reddit

Navigating the Market and Finding Deals

The Centro Artesanal Cusco is a bustling marketplace with hundreds of stalls, offering a wide array of goods. While the sheer volume can be overwhelming, it also means there's plenty of room for negotiation. Many visitors advise comparing prices across different vendors before making a purchase, as similar items can vary in cost. Reddit

Bargaining is an integral part of the shopping experience here. Approach it with a friendly attitude and a smile. Start with a reasonable offer lower than the asking price, and be prepared to meet somewhere in the middle. Remember that the prices are often inflated for tourists, so don't be afraid to negotiate respectfully. TikTok

For those looking for the absolute best prices, some travelers suggest that San Pedro Market offers comparable items at even lower costs. However, the Centro Artesanal provides a more curated artisan experience and is still significantly cheaper than many shops in the main tourist areas. Reddit

Cusco's Historic Charm and Artisan Hub

The Centro Artesanal Cusco is situated in the heart of the city's historic center, an area renowned for its stunning colonial architecture and Inca foundations. The surrounding streets are a visual delight, blending Spanish colonial buildings with ancient Inca stonework. Instagram+1

Exploring the area around the market is an experience in itself. You'll find yourself walking past picturesque plazas, impressive monuments, and beautiful fountains. The Plaza de Armas and Plazoleta el Regocijo are nearby, offering opportunities to admire landmarks like the Cusco Cathedral and the Museum of Contemporary Art. Instagram+1

This central location makes the Centro Artesanal a convenient stop while sightseeing. It's a place where you can immerse yourself in the local culture, appreciate traditional crafts, and find unique souvenirs to remember your trip to this magical city. TikTok
